调用AI大模型的核心在于通过API接口将Prompt精准转化为Token流,并配合合理的上下文管理与并发控制,以实现低成本、高稳定性的业务集成。
在2026年的技术语境下,AI大模型的调用早已不再是简单的“提问-回答”游戏,而是企业级应用的基础设施,许多开发者在初期往往陷入“直接硬调”的误区,导致响应延迟高、成本不可控,高效的调用策略需要结合业务场景,从接口选择、参数调优到错误重试机制,形成一套完整的工程化闭环。
API接口选型与基础接入流程
选择合适的模型提供商是第一步,目前市场上主流的服务商包括百度文心一言、阿里通义千问、智谱AI以及开源社区的各类微调模型,对于国内企业而言,数据合规性与响应速度是首要考量因素。
国内主流大模型API对比分析
不同模型在长文本处理、逻辑推理及代码生成能力上各有侧重,业内专家指出,企业在选型时不应盲目追求参数规模,而应关注特定场景下的性价比。
| 模型类型 | 优势场景 | 典型延迟 (ms) | 计费模式 |
|---|---|---|---|
| 通用对话型 | 创作 | 500-1200 | 按Token计费 |
| 代码专用型 | 辅助编程、Bug修复 | 300-800 | 按Token计费 |
| 视觉理解型 | 文档OCR、图像分析 | 1000-2000 | 按图片张数+Token |
| 本地部署型 | 数据隐私敏感场景 | 依赖硬件 |
一次性授权+运维 |
获取API Key的标准路径
- 注册开发者账号:访问对应云服务平台,完成企业实名认证。
- 创建应用:在控制台新建应用,获取唯一的
API Key和Secret Key。 - 权限配置:根据业务需求开通相应模型的调用权限,注意区分免费额度与付费额度。
- 环境配置:将密钥存入环境变量(如
.env文件),严禁硬编码在源代码中。
Prompt工程与上下文管理策略
调用大模型的本质是信息输入与输出的映射,如何设计Prompt(提示词)以及管理上下文窗口,直接决定了最终效果的稳定性。
结构化提示词编写技巧
简单的指令往往导致输出不可控,推荐使用结构化框架,如CRISPE或BROKE,明确角色、背景、任务、约束和期望格式。
- 角色设定:明确AI的身份,你是一位资深Python架构师”。
- 背景信息:提供必要的上下文,如“我正在开发一个高并发电商系统”。
- 任务描述:具体且单一,避免多重指令混淆,请优化以下代码段的数据库连接池逻辑”。
- 输出约束:规定格式,如“仅输出JSON格式,包含字段:code, message, data”。
处理长文本的上下文截断方案
当对话历史超过模型的最大上下文窗口时,直接截断会导致信息丢失,常见的解决方案包括:
- 滑动窗口法:保留最近N轮对话,丢弃较早内容,适用于闲聊场景,但对逻辑连贯性要求高的场景效果不佳。
- 摘要压缩法:利用小模型对早期对话进行摘要,将摘要与新问题一起输入,据工信部数据,这种方法在保持上下文完整性的同时,能显著降低Token消耗。
- 向量检索增强(RAG):将历史文档向量化存入数据库,按需检索相关片段注入Prompt,这是目前企业级应用的主流做法,尤其适用于“大模型知识库问答”场景。

成本控制与性能优化实战
在实际生产环境中,API调用成本往往超出预算,且高并发下容易出现超时或限流,优化策略需从代码层面和架构层面同时入手。
降低Token消耗的具体方法
Token是计费的基本单位,减少无效Token的使用是降本的关键。
- 精简Prompt:去除冗余的礼貌用语和重复指令,使用更精准的动词。
- 缓存机制:对于相同或相似的输入,建立Redis缓存层,据统计,多数情况下,重复请求占比可达20%-30%,缓存可大幅降低API调用次数。
- 模型降级策略:设置优先级,简单问题调用轻量级模型(如7B参数模型),复杂逻辑再调用旗舰模型(如100B+参数模型)。
并发控制与重试机制实现
网络波动和服务端限流是常见痛点,建议采用指数退避重试算法,而非固定间隔重试。
import time
import requests
def call_llm_with_retry(prompt, max_retries=3):
for attempt in range(max_retries):
try:
response = requests.post(api_url, json={"prompt": prompt}, timeout=10)
response.raise_for_status()
return response.json()
except requests.exceptions.RequestException as e:
if attempt == max_retries - 1:
raise e
wait_time = 2 attempt # 指数退避:1s, 2s, 4s
time.sleep(wait_time)
常见误区与避坑指南
许多团队在接入大模型时,容易陷入技术崇拜或过度设计的陷阱。
幻觉问题的应对
大模型会产生“幻觉”,即生成看似合理但事实错误的内容。
- 事实核查:对于关键数据,务必通过外部知识库或数据库进行二次验证。
- 置信度评分:部分模型支持输出置信度,低置信度结果应标记为“待人工审核”。
- 引用溯源:在RAG场景中,强制模型标注信息来源,便于用户追溯。

安全与合规边界
- 数据脱敏:上传Prompt前,必须对姓名、身份证、银行卡号等敏感信息进行掩码处理。
- 内容过滤:在服务端部署内容安全审核层,拦截违规输入和输出。
- 版权意识:避免使用未经授权的受版权保护内容作为训练数据或Prompt素材。
2026年大模型调用趋势展望
随着技术演进,大模型的调用方式正从“单次请求”向“智能体(Agent)协作”转变。
多模型协同工作流
单一模型难以胜任复杂任务,通过工作流引擎(如LangChain、Dify),将多个模型串联,实现“规划-执行-反思”的闭环,一个模型负责拆解任务,另一个负责代码生成,第三个负责代码审查。
端侧模型与云侧模型的混合部署
为了进一步降低延迟和保护隐私,小型化、高效化的端侧模型将在手机、PC等终端普及,日常简单交互由端侧模型处理,复杂任务再上传至云端大模型,这种混合架构将成为主流,特别是在“手机端大模型应用”场景中表现突出。
常见问题解答(Q&A)
大模型API调用出现429错误怎么办?
429错误表示请求频率超过限制,解决方法包括:实施指数退避重试机制,降低并发请求数,或联系服务商申请提高配额。
如何评估不同大模型在特定任务上的效果?
构建包含黄金标准答案的测试集,使用自动化脚本批量调用各模型,计算准确率、召回率及F1分数,引入人工评估环节,重点考察逻辑一致性和语言自然度。
大模型调用的价格通常是多少?
价格因模型规格而异,输入Token价格低于输出Token价格,主流模型的输入价格约为每百万Token几元至十几元人民币,输出价格则更高,具体价格需参考各服务商最新官网公示,且常有新用户免费额度活动。
首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/374656.html

